A sports editor is a journalism professional who is responsible for assigning and editing stories about sports and athletes. As a sports editor, your job duties include maintaining contacts with professional writers and media professionals in the sports industry and assigning stories to reporters. You also work closely with the marketing and sales departments at your publication as well as the executives, with whom you discuss budgets and coverage. Some sports editors focus on a specific sport or division, such as college or professional, while others may have more general responsibilities, covering a number of sports.
